31,576,064 is a composite number, even.
31,576,064 (thirty-one million five hundred seventy-six thousand sixty-four) is an even 8-digit number. It is a composite number with 52 divisors, and factors as 2¹² × 13 × 593. Its proper divisors sum to 36,540,292,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x1E1D000.
